Measurements

What has actually been measured

Two numbers are only comparable when they share a metric and a protocol version. Every figure on this site carries benchmark@version and a run date for exactly that reason — putting two differently-produced numbers in one table is the fastest way for a site like this to stop being worth reading.

No runs yet. The protocols below are written down first, deliberately, so the numbers cannot be shaped to fit a story after the fact. Nothing on this site is presented as measured until a run file exists to back it.

Protocols

Browser snapshot cost — What does one page observation cost, and what does the server charge before it does anything?

For each candidate, install the server into a clean harness and record tool-count (tools registered) and schema-tokens (the serialised tool schemas, tokenised with o200k_base) before any call is made. Then drive the three fixture pages below: navigate, take one observation with the server's default observation tool at default settings, and tokenise the full tool result. Report the median of the three pages as snapshot-tokens. No model is invoked — this is characterisation, not behaviour, so the numbers are exact rather than distributional. Record failures to install as status:error with a note; a server that cannot be installed is a finding, not a blank cell.
